Output 3e84bbdbb37b3f266960eb3248a6cd8e80e7c97ad33e15a5b9708e2e3b78c580:4

value
89059397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46242f86790fe91fb1032f8185a8133966b27666 OP_EQUAL
address
MEJ2t5evGFS6hu28BLbKB9aUQ1MMtknR59
transaction
3e84bbdbb37b3f266960eb3248a6cd8e80e7c97ad33e15a5b9708e2e3b78c580
spent
true